Is “Wicked” a Wicked for Kids Movie?

The musical “Wicked” has been a staple on Broadway for over a decade, captivating audiences with its enchanting score and captivating story. However, the question remains: Is “Wicked” a wicked for kids movie? While the show is undoubtedly entertaining and thought-provoking, it’s essential to consider its content and themes before deciding if it’s suitable for young viewers.

Complex Themes and Mature Content

“Wicked” delves into complex themes such as good versus evil, the nature of friendship, and the consequences of one’s actions. While these themes can be beneficial for older children and teenagers to explore, they may be too mature for younger audiences. The show contains moments of violence, including a dramatic death scene, as well as references to adult situations that might not be appropriate for young children.
